补阳还五汤对缺氧-复氧损伤内皮细胞的保护作用

Protective Effects of Buyang Huanwu Decoction on Endothelial Cells Cultured in Hypoxia Reoxygenation Circumstance

【摘要】 目的探讨补阳还五汤(BHD)对缺氧-复氧损伤内皮细胞(ECV)的保护作用。方法体外培养人脐静脉内皮细胞株ECV304,缺氧-复氧造成ECV损伤,同时加入不同剂量BHD,检测细胞丙二醛(MDA)、培养上清液中乳酸脱氢酶(LDH)、内皮素-1(ET-1)及一氧化氮(NO)的含量变化。结果ECV304缺氧-复氧后,与空白组比较,LDH、MDA及ET-1含量显著升高(P<0.01),而NO含量显著下降(P<0.05)。当加入低、中、高剂量的BHD或尼莫地平阳性对照药后,与缺氧-复氧模型组比较,LDH、MDA及ET-1含量下降(P<0.01或P<0.05),而NO含量升高(P<0.01)。结论BHD能抑制缺氧-复氧对ECV的损伤,对缺氧-复氧环境下的ECV起保护作用。

【Abstract】 Objective To investigate protective effects of Buyang Huanwu decoction (BDH) on endothelial cell line ECV304 cultured in hypoxia reoxygenation circumstance. Methods The effects of ECV304 were determined by measuring MDA in cells and LDH, ET-1, NO in the supernatant. Results In the circumstance of hypoxia reoxygenation, the contents of LDH, MDA, ET-1 were markedly increased (P<0.01), and the contents of NO were markedly reduced (P<0.05). Treatment with different concentrations of BHD or controlling drug either caused a reduction in the LDH, MDA, ET-1 contents and an increase in the NO contents (P<0.01 or P<0.05). Conclusions BHD can inhibit the release of LDH, MDA, ET-1 and promote the release of NO in endothelial cells in the circumstance of hypoxia reoxygenation. In this way, it may be effective in the protection of endothelial cells in the circumstance of hypoxia reoxygenation.
